Members of the Convention People\u2019s Party (CPP) are expected to gather at the Ghana Academy of Arts and Science today [Saturday] to witness the launch of the party\u2019s 2016 manifesto.<\/p>\n

Speaking to Citi News<\/strong>\u00a0 the party\u2019s Communications Director, Issifu Kadiri Abdul Rauf said they are expecting about a thousand members at the venue.<\/p>\n

He added that they are also expecting all their 222 parliamentary candidates and executives of their various campaign committees at the launch.<\/p>\n

\u201cAll the necessary things that we have to do in order to have a successful programme at the Ghana Academy of Arts and Science have been done. We are expecting close to 1,000 members.\u201d<\/p>\n

Issifu Kadiri further noted that several speakers will address the gathering and they have selected some experts within the CPP to speak on various sectors in the manifesto<\/p>\n

\u201cWe have broken the manifesto into different parts, key sectors and we have brought experts in the party to speak to those areas,\u201d he added.<\/p>\n
